sweet potato fries air fryer Ingredients
For the Sweet Potatoes
- 2 medium sweet potatoes – Peeled and cut into fries, these provide a naturally sweet flavor that pairs beautifully with savory seasonings.
For the Oil and Seasoning
- 1 tablespoon olive oil – This helps to coat the fries evenly for an extra crispy texture in the air fryer.
- 1 teaspoon salt – Adjust to taste; salt enhances the natural sweetness of the sweet potatoes.
- 1 teaspoon paprika (optional) – Adds a mild smokiness and vibrant color, elevating your sweet potato fries air fryer experience.
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der (optional) – Infuses a delicious garlicky flavor that complements the sweetness of the potatoes perfectly.
How to Make sweet potato fries air fryer

1. Preheat the air fryer to 400°F (200°C).
A hot air fryer ensures that your sweet potato fries cook evenly and get that delicious crispiness we all love.
2. Toss the sweet potato fries in a large bowl with olive oil, salt, paprika, and garlic powder until evenly coated.
The combination of 2 medium sweet potatoes, 1 tablespoon olive oil, and seasonings will enhance their natural sweetness!
3. Arrange the fries in the air fryer basket in a single layer, making sure not to overcrowd.
This helps each fry achieve that perfect golden-brown exterior while keeping them tender inside.
4. Cook for 15-20 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king.
Keep an eye on them; you want that beautiful crispy texture without burning!
5. Check for your desired crispiness; if you prefer them crunchier, feel free to cook longer as needed.
It might take an extra minute or two for those perfect fries to emerge!
6. Remove the fries from the air fryer and let them cool slightly before serving.
Patience is key here—allowing them to sit enhances their crunchiness.
7. Serve with your favorite dipping sauce for a delightful snack or side dish!

Pro Tips for sweet potato fries air fryer
- Cut Evenly: Make sure your sweet potatoes are cut into uniform sizes. This ensures they cook evenly and achieve that perfect crisp.
- Don’t Overcrowd: Place the fries in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Overcrowding can lead to soggy fries instead of crispy sweet potato fries air fryer.
- Adjust Cooking Time: Keep an eye on the cooking time; each air fryer may vary. Check for crispiness and add extra time if needed.
- Coat Well: Tossing the fries thoroughly with olive oil and seasonings helps them crisp up nicely. A light coat is all you need for flavor without greasiness.
- Shake It Up: Remember to shake the basket halfway through cooking. This promotes even browning and prevents sticking, ensuring delicious results every time.
- Cool Before Serving: Letting the fries cool slightly after cooking helps maintain their crispiness, so resist the urge to dive in right away!
How to Store and Freeze sweet potato fries air fryer
- Room Temperature: Sweet potato fries air fryer can be kept at room temperature for up to 2 hours. Ensure they are in a covered dish to maintain freshness.
- Fridge: Store leftover fries in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at them in the air fryer or oven for extra crispiness.
- Freezer: For longer storage, freeze uncooked sweet potato fries on a baking sheet until firm, then transfer to a freezer bag. They can last up to 3 months.
- Reheating: When ready to enjoy, reheat frozen fries directly in the air fryer at 400°F (200°C) for about 10-15 minutes until crispy and heated through.

Make Ahead Options

If you’re looking to streamline your meal prep, these sweet potato fries air fryer are an excellent choice! You can peel and cut the two medium sweet potatoes into fries up to 24 hours in advance. Just store them in a bowl of water in the refrigerator to prevent browning. The seasoning mix—olive oil, salt, paprika, and garlic powder—can be prepped ahead as well; simply combine these ingredients and keep them in an airtight container for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to enjoy, just pre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C), toss the fries in the seasoning, and cook them for 15-20 minutes. sweet potato fries air fryer Recipe FAQs
What type of sweet potatoes are best for making fries?
For the crispiest and most flavorful sweet potato fries, opt for medium-sized, firm sweet potatoes. Look for those with smooth skin and vibrant color. The sweeter varieties will provide a delightful contrast to the seasoning, making each bite a treat!
Can I adjust the seasoning in my sweet potato fries?
Absolutely! The beauty of this recipe lies in its versatility. Feel free to experiment with different spices like cayenne pepper for heat or even Italian seasoning for an herby twist. Just remember to keep the base of 1 tablespoon olive oil and 1 teaspoon salt to ensure your fries remain deliciously crispy.
How long can I store leftover air fryer sweet potato fries?
If you have any leftovers (which is rare, but it happens!), store the cooled fries in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at them while keeping their crispiness, pop them back into the air fryer at 375°F (190°C) for about 5 minutes.
Can I freeze sweet potato fries before cooking?
Yes! You can freeze uncooked sweet potato fries for up to 3 months. Spread them out on a baking sheet after coating them with oil and seasonings, then freeze until solid. Once frozen, transfer them to a freezer-safe bag. When you’re ready to cook, there’s no need to thaw; just add a couple of extra minutes to your cooking time.
What should I do if my sweet potato fries are soggy?
Sogginess often comes from overcrowding the air fryer basket or not cooking at a high enough temperature. Make sure your fries are in a single layer and give them room to breathe! If they still don’t turn out as crispy as you’d like, try increasing the cook time by a couple of minutes while checking frequently after the initial 15-20 minutes.
